When I run the following command:

yiic webapp main /home/david123/domains/david123.servehttp.com/public_html/main

It waits for my answer:

Create a Web application under '/home/david123/domains/david123.servehttp.com/public_html/main'? [Yes|No] 

Rather than entering Yes/No each time I run this command, I would like to pre-supply the answer to the command. What should I append to my original command?

yiic webapp main /home/david123/domains/david123.servehttp.com/public_html/main

You should prepend an invocation of yes.

yes Yes | yiic webapp main /home/david123/domains/david123.servehttp.com/public_html/main

    The yes command will keep supplying yesses whether the program needs them or not. Dec 21, 2011 at 0:46
